Ingredients: Stampin' Up products: Papers--Basic Black cs, Very Vanilla cs, In Good Taste dsp. Copper Foil (saved from an envelope insert). Stamps--Amazing Life (sentiment); Dies--Call Me Cupcake (framelits), Stitched Rectangles; Inks (sponging)--Bermuda Bay, Call Me Clover, Cherry Cobbler, Melon Mango; Clear Embossing Powder; 3/8" Black Shimmer ribbon; Metallic Brads. Other: Copic Markers. Inside--Chatterbox verse. EK Victorian Corner punch. Size: 4-3/4" x 6."
